Three Dead, Two Injured in Route 9 Crash in Tucumán

Authorities are probing the single-vehicle impact with forensic reports pending.

  • A Renault Sandero traveling from south to north lost control around 7:00–7:10 a.m. and struck eucalyptus trees at kilometer 1170 near Mancopa–El Bracho.
  • The victims who died at the scene were identified as Olga Estela Morán, Cecilia Vizeta Orrieta, and Luis Leonardo Suárez.
  • Driver Lucas Nahuel Orrieta, 20, was taken to the Hospital de El Bracho with serious injuries, and a minor passenger was transferred to a hospital in the provincial capital.
  • Police said all five occupants were from Santiago del Estero.
  • Officers, firefighters, road crews, and forensic specialists attended the scene, and the precise cause of the crash remains under investigation.
